Obligation to remain at home for the Improta murder, the Court of Cassation annuls the order of the Review for Perone

Benevento. The 12rd Section of the Supreme Court of Cassation, accepting the appeal filed by Attorney Vittorio Fucci Jr., has annulled, with referral, the order of the Court of Review of Naples, dated April 48, which confirmed the order, issued by the Judge of Preliminary Investigations of Benevento, of the precautionary custody of the obligation to remain at home against Eugenio Perone, 2018 years old, of Montesarchio, accused of aggravated aiding and abetting to evade investigations in relation to the murder of Valentino Improta which occurred in May XNUMX. The order was based on wiretaps and environmental interceptions, as well as on the statements of several witnesses. Before the trial in Cassation, which annulled the order of the Court of Review of Naples, Perone had already been replaced by the measure of the obligation to remain at home with that of the obligation to report to the Judicial Police.
Meanwhile, the immediate trial for the defendants charged with murder is expected to be scheduled for July 16th, unless an alternative trial is requested. Valentino Improta, 26, was killed with two gunshot wounds; his charred body was found on May 4, 2018, in a Fiat Punto in Cepino di Tocco Caudio on Mount Taburno. Paolo Spitaletta, 50, of Tocco Caudio, and Pierluigi Rotondi, 31, of Tufara, are accused of the crime. The two abettors of the murders are believed to be Eugenio Perone of Bonea and Sandro Cerulo, 36, of Cautano. According to investigators, the crime occurred during a robbery on April 10, 2018, which was followed by the death of an 83-year-old man two weeks later. According to the Carabinieri, Improta was one of the perpetrators of the raid along with Spitaletta, who was jailed on May 22, 2018, for that very robbery.
